REPORT: Chelsea duo lose young player award

According to reports, Chelsea duo Christian Pulisic and Mason Mount were both nominated for the inaugural Young Player of the Season award.

However, The duo were part of on an eight-man shortlist for the prize which goes to the best-performing player aged 23 or younger at the start of the season.

Unfortunately, they both lost the award, as it was given to Liverpool defender Trent Alexander-Arnold. Alexander-Arnold indeed had a wonderful season, and both Mount or Pulisic can’t complain of losing to him.

The Liverpool full-back had a successful season, after providing 13 assists, as the Reds won their first Premier League trophy in three decades.

Pulisic had a very good end to the season, as he was one of the league’s best players following the restart of the season. Although he wasn’t at his best at the start of last season. However, we can now look forward to a top performance from the American next season.

For Mason Mount, no Chelsea player made more Premier League appearances for us this season than 21-year-old Mount (37), who scored seven goals and registered five assists.
